Frequently Asked Questions about Fourth Ward

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Fourth Ward area of Houston, TX?

As of today, August 31, 2026, there are currently 860 available Fourth Ward apartments priced from $520 to $17,381, with an average monthly rent of $2,188.

How much are Studio apartments in Fourth Ward?

There are currently 200 Studio Apartments in Fourth Ward with rent ranges from $695 to $5,000 with an average price of $1,555.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Fourth Ward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Fourth Ward ranges from $520 to $5,471 with an average monthly rent of $1,855.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Fourth Ward c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Fourth Ward range from $624 to $13,217.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,819.

How expensive are Fourth Ward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 84 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Fourth Ward on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,145 to $17,381 - averaging $5,059 for the location.
